”Jesus Loves Addicts” is a podcast that explores the transformative power of faith and the Gospel in the lives of those struggling with addiction. Each episode features personal stories of recovery, interviews with experts in the field, and practical advice for individuals and families affected by addiction. The show aims to offer hope, encouragement, and guidance for those seeking to break free from the cycle of addiction and find healing through the love and grace of Jesus Christ.Copyright © 2026 Home of Grace.     • 90. Generational Patterns - Part 1(w/ Ashley and Zach Buckalew)
      Jan 26 2026

      In this episode hosts talk with Zach Buckalew and his wife Ashley Buckalew about surviving childhood trauma, parental addiction, and sexual abuse, and how those experiences led to long battles with substances (OxyContin, meth, Subutex and more). Both share candid memories of growing up in chaotic homes, the consequences of addiction, and the moment faith and community began to change their lives.

      Listeners will hear about key turning points—meeting at a tent revival, treatment programs like Agape Life Gardens, the role of forgiveness, and the power of Christ-centered recovery. Honest, vulnerable, and faith-focused, the conversation challenges stigma, highlights practical struggles and victories in sobriety, and offers hope for anyone facing addiction or supporting a loved one.

    • 89: Naive to Addiction (w/ Justin Edward)
      Jan 19 2026

      In this episode Justin Edwards from Ocean Springs, Mississippi, tells his 20+ year story of addiction — starting with teenage drinking and weed, escalating through college cocaine and prescription opioids, shooting drugs, multiple treatment attempts, an overdose and ICU stay, and the devastating loss of his girlfriend to fentanyl. He candidly describes hitting rock bottom (including a terrifying moment on a bridge), repeated relapses, prison and drug court, and the turning point that led him back to treatment and faith.

      Hosts and guest explore the practical and spiritual realities of recovery: the ritual of addiction, family intervention, the influence of environment and work, and the role of the Home of Grace. Justin shares how a renewed relationship with Jesus, humility, community, and obedience reshaped his life — offering real hope and clear takeaways for anyone struggling or supporting a loved one through addiction.

    • 88. Looking in the Mirror (w/ Lawren and Randall Cobb)
      Jan 12 2026

      In this episode of Jesus Loves Addicts, father-daughter guests Randall and Lawren Cobb share a raw, hopeful conversation about addiction, family, and faith. Lawren recounts her six-year struggle with meth—starting with middle-school insecurities, progressing to self-harm and homelessness, and culminating in violent relationships—while Randall describes the pain and difficult boundaries of parenting a child in active addiction. They discuss signs parents can look for, the harm of secrecy, the value of tough love and boundaries, and the pivotal role of Christ-centered recovery programs like Wings of Life and Home of Grace.

      Key topics include the influence of social media on self-image, how addiction can hide behind achievements, the importance of community and prayer, and how faith and honest conversations restore relationships. Guests reflect on relapse, treatment journeys, angelic interventions, and the ongoing process of rebuilding trust. Listeners will hear both practical guidance for families and a hopeful testimony of redemption: three years sober, restored relationships, and a new life working with animals and serving in recovery ministry.
